### 4.2.1 — Changed defaults

Quillbus now enables log compaction by default on all topics. Retention-by-time still applies; compaction runs after. Expect higher disk churn on brokers for the first 24h post-upgrade. If consumers rely on full history, opt out per topic before rolling. Rollback restores old defaults but does not un-compact segments. The new defaults applied at broker start are these.

settings of tagef-bawif:
DRUIX_HOST=druix.zemvarlabs.internal
DRUIX_PORT=8000

Hey there,

Welcome to the StockMender rotation! The nightly inventory reconciliation job is mostly boring (the best kind), but a couple of things bite newcomers. First, if the job stalls past 3 a.m., don't just retry — check whether the warehouse feed from the Ostbridge depot finished, or you'll double-count transfers. Second, partial failures are safe to rerun; full failures are not. Future maintainers, please keep this note updated as quirks change. The full runbook, with commands and escalation order, lives here.

dashboard of tawef-hagug = https://superset.norvadyn.local/display/projects/build/ticket/build/spaces/ticket/1e989f0e6c200d20fc4ae06b

Subject: Telemetry gateway ownership change

Team — effective next Monday, responsibility for the HarrowLink farm-equipment telemetry gateway moves out of the Platform group. Routine firmware rollouts, ingestion alerts, and vendor escalations will all route to the new owner. Please update your runbooks before the weekly sync. The new responsible engineer is named below.

named custodian: Belius Casath Ulaix Sorius